Output 39db2661d51b54b7f10793ebecf92f30d2b6a2bf8a8da3eaf0e39dd11dcc935c:1

value
2418389
script pubkey
OP_0 OP_PUSHBYTES_20 89b31f6d96df087a7311aaf11a8fe9b138bedfff
address
bc1q3xe37mvkmuy85uc34tc34rlfkyutahll7lf79c
transaction
39db2661d51b54b7f10793ebecf92f30d2b6a2bf8a8da3eaf0e39dd11dcc935c
spent
true